Most Canopus cards (DV Storm, DV Raptor, EZDV) come with their prop software; in your case, it should probably be RaptorEdit/RaptorVideo...
You probably have some plugins for Premiere in the installation CD. That will allow you to use Premiere. But without that, I doubt. The cards I mentioned are not general purpose IEEE1394 cards, but DV-specific cards only, that 3rd party softwares won't work out of the box.
But then, the canopus software is so user friendly, and powerful enough that it should do a good job for basic NLEs.
